Effect of Gui Qi San andits separated prescription on immunoregulative effect in mice

Abstract: Aim Theimmunoregula tive Effect of Gui Qi San andits separated prescription on immune functions of mice was to be studied.Methods Theeffect of Gui Qi San and its separated prescription only mphocytes was observed after theimmune function of mice was damaged by cyclophosphamide.Results They could evidently counteract mice spleen degeneration caused by cyclophosphamide or improve their life quality, promote immunosuppressied mice T.Blymphocytes proliferation, act ivate NK cells, increase CD4+/CD8+cells ratroby increasing CD4+ cell, and lowerecAMP level in spleen cell.Thecompo site prescription had bettereffectthan its separated prescription and PSP.It had no Effect on immune function of normal mice.Conclusion Gui Qi S an andits separated prescription hadimmunoregulative Effect on immunosuppressied mice.

Key words: Gui Qi San, separated prescription, lymphocytes, immunoregulation
